Baked Lemon Pepper Chicken Wings

My Baked Lemon Pepper Chicken wings are spicy, salty and tangy! These chicken wings are baked (instead of fried!) and are still super crispy and flavourful!

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 35 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 2

Ingredients
  

  • 2 tablespoons black peppercorns
  • 1 tablespoon salt
  • 2 pounds chicken wings
  • 2 tablespoons avocado oil
  • 1 tablespoon lemon zest
  • 1/2 lemon sliced in wedges
  • 2 tablespoons Italian parsley finely chopped

Instructions
 

  • Begin by making the salt and pepper mixture. Add the peppercorns to a mortar and bash them with a pestle to break them up. Once broken up, add the salt and grind them together until the mixture begins to become powdery, but there are some larger chucks of peppercorn still left. Set aside for now.
  • Add the chicken wings to a large bowl. Add 1 tablespoon of avocado oil and half of the salt and pepper mixture. Mix until combined and set aside.
  •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F.
  • Line a baking tray with parchment paper and set a oven-safe wire rack on top. Brush the remaining 1 tablespoon of avocado oil on to the wire rack so that the chicken wings don't stick while baking.
  • Add the chicken wings to the wire rack, skin side up. Bake in the center of the oven for 35 minutes.
  • After 35 minutes, move the chicken wings up under the oven broiler and broil for 1-2 minutes, or until the skin gets really crisp and turns golden brown. Remove from the oven and let cool for one minute.
  • Transfer the warm chicken wings to a large bowl. Add the lemon zest and remaining salt and pepper mixture and toss to combine.
  • Place the chicken wings on a serving plate and garnish with lemon wedges and chopped parsley. Enjoy!
